Hi, i'm a new user of ADINA and i have this problem: I'm doing a non linear analysis of a continuous beam on three supports. When is generated the plastic hinge on the central support , the bending moment go down to zero but i want to see the plasic bending moment. For the modelling i have followed the Problem 14 (pushover analysis of a frame) of the Primer, without put the rigid end. I ask if there are other option to set.
